BB&E is currently looking for a Construction Manager to Support BB&E’s A&AS contract, assisting NAVFAC Mid-Atlantic, supporting facilities design and construction projects on-site at Naval Station Newport, RI.
Job Duties & Responsibilities
- Tactfully and professionally communicate (orally and in writing) NAVFAC requirements and positions and engage at multiple levels of authority to obtain decisive action from all affected parties, including the Construction Contractor (Contractor), Supported Commands, and other Agencies; must understand that their recommendations will be strongly considered in forming the basis for final action by field office leadership
- Review pre-final contract drawings and specifications (including technical RFPs) with respect to constructability and compatibility with actual field conditions
- Participate in pre-award contract meetings, such as Functional Analysis Concept Development (FACDs) meetings and constructability reviews
- Coordinate post-award contract meetings, such as post-award kickoff meetings (as applicable), preconstruction conferences, (informal or formal) partnering meetings, schedule acceptance meeting, design review meetings (as applicable), LEED coordination meetings (as applicable), Facility Turnover Planning Meetings (NAVFAC Red Zone), and final inspections
- Review contractor administrative submittals, such as : schedules (both bar charts and networks); environmental protection plan; design (as applicable) and construction quality control (QC) plan; health and safety plan; and accident prevention plan, and coordinate review and recommend approval or rejection of technical "Government-approved" submittals, such as shop drawings, product data, samples, design data, manufacturer's instructions, test plans / reports, certificates, and O&M data in a timely manner
- Visit construction sites to monitor progress and solicit input from the Engineering Technician / Quality Assurance (ET / QA) representatives, review CQC reports and attend QC meetings; recommend necessary action to ensure contractor's QC program is provided in accordance with the contract requirements and that the three phases of quality control are being followed
- Based on technical knowledge and coordination with designer and construction contractor, provide technical solutions to unforeseen problems during construction; may include independently reviewing field changes that have no impact on the function of the facility or scope, cost, or schedule of the contract
- Provide project status updates to senior Government personnel within the field office
- Prepare property record inventory documents for Government Project Manager, DD1354 Transfer and Acceptance of Military Real Property and Disposal of DoN Real Property, in accordance with NAVFAC Business Management System (BMS) and in coordination with Project Managers and Installation Real Property Accountable Officer (RPAO)
- Complete required items to assist in effectively closing out a contract, including tracking receipt and delivery of as-built drawings, O&M manuals / eOMSI and warranty documents for the Supported Command / facility manager or local PWD, in accordance with NAVFAC BMS
- Keep the Government sponsor advised as to the status of projects, but the responsibility to plan and carry out the assignment is accomplished independently
